SYMPTOM RELATED DIAGNOSTICS BUFFERED MPH (SPEEDOMETER SIGNAL)

When performing electrical tests, it is important to wiggle wires and connectors to identify intermittent connection problems.

Test 1

Checking for an external fault

1.Turn the ignition key to the OFF position.

2.Disconnect all external units at the buffered MPH external tie point (located near the accessory bus).

3.Test drive the vehicle.

If a diagnostic blink code 4-3 is active, proceed to the MPH Sensor Diagnostic.

If the speedometer is now working, there is a short in the external harness or component. Locate and repair the short. Retest to be sure the problem has been corrected.

If the speedometer still does not work, proceed to Test 2.

This diagnostic procedure starts from a customer complaint that the speedometer is not working.
